Microscopic Evaluation of Different Sealant Materials

Objectives: The aim of this study was to compare in vitro penetration and adaptation of light curing ormocer based fissure sealant and non­filled low viscosity sealant material. Materials and Methods: Extracted human molars (n = 108) were randomly assigned to 2 groups. Admira Seal and Teethmate F­1 were used as sealant materials in the study. Each tooth was sectioned using an Isomet cutter into 2 portions bucco­lingually, producing mesial and distal tooth halve. The penetration, adaptation and voids of 2 materials were evaluated according to fissure shape and depth at the stereo­light microscope, and from each group 10 samples were examined under scanning electron microscope (SEM). Results: Under light microscope and SEM, ormocer based fissure sealant (Admira Seal) and non­filled low viscosity sealant material (Teethmate F­1) did not show significantly different statistical results when penetration and adaptation were compared (p>0.05).
